One thing that ALWAYS bothers me about Be A Pro is the fact that you're always drafted in the draft that has just gone by, and keeps the results of that same draft bringing in the duplicate draft picks (if Owen Powers was in the game, Buffalo would have had him AND the created player that went first in my draft as I went to Seattle). I want to see EA get rid of the duplicate draft, and allow us to either be drafted in the 2022 draft, competing with those drafted in 2022 (redoing the draft order in the process) , or start our Be A Pro in our draft year for the 2023 Draft in NHL 23

@ccleme20Awesome and well thought out post. Some things I’d like to see are;
1. Free Skate/ Practice with your player. While I would like your idea better, all they would have to do is add your BAP player to the roster of that team. Go into Training mode and pick your scenario. Granted it’s not the same having to control all of the other players but at the very least you could free skate. I only play WoC and BAP and it’s jarring coming from from my WoC character to my BAP scrub. I’d like to be able to go into free skate to see what shots and dekes I can actually pull off compared to my WoC skater.
Back to your idea, I played UFC 4 this year. It was the first UFC game I’d ever played. What hooked me was the career mode and training camp. I liked that I actually had to practice the skills I wanted to level. That would be a nice addition to BAP. Maybe not as in depth becuase of how long seasons are but something more than what we have.
2. Team / Teammate AI. I wouldn’t care that we can’t select strategies IF every coach/team had variations or personality but no matter what team you play on it’s the same. Dump the puck in the offensive zone or turn to the boards and wait to be pinned in either zone. Opposing AI will cycle the puck while AI teammates let them but the second you enter the offensive zone, you get rushed by the entire team.
Either give each team unique game plans / strategies or let us choose these in the AI section of the slider menu. They already exist for franchise and HUT so implementing in BAP shouldn’t be hard?
3. The option to restart a game. Man this one sucks in all modes. WoC Pro-AM and BAP are the worst since it takes so long to get back into the game. I try to take my lumps as they come but sometimes the AI does some really dumb stuff that I’m not willing to either take a loss over or spend the next 30min playing. The AI has improved but adding a restart option to the game menu would be awesome.
4. I love the addition of abilities but the unlocks have to be reworked. I like having things to grind for but play 5 years on the same team? I don’t like simming games but it looks like I’m going to have to start unless they change some of these.
5. Give us more to do off ice if we want. Mainly with the salary perks, trading/contract options and social media stuff. And we need more lines / commentary that can span a career.
6. With the NHL series being an annual release, I would LOVE to be able continue my BAP career in the latest release. There’s no way you’re getting far into any career without simming a ton before the next NHL installment. Let us transfer our player to the new version .
